Question

Jake is installing a staircase so his children can have access to a tree house he built. The rise of the stairs is 7 inches and the run of each stair Is 10 Inches. What is the slope of the staircase, expressed as a fraction?

Solution

Verified
Step 1
1 of 2

Determine the slope of the staircase.

slope=riserunWrite the formula for slopeslope=710Substitute the values\begin{align*} \text{slope} &= \dfrac{\text{rise}}{\text{run}} && \text{Write the formula for slope}\\ \text{slope} &= \dfrac{7}{10} && \text{Substitute the values} \end{align*}
